THE police in North Yorkshire will not face action in connection with disgraced presenter Jimmy Savile.
The Independent Police Complaints Commission (IPCC) had investigated the force over the contact officers had with Savile who had a home in Scarborough, "in light of information received" online.
Moir Stewart, the IPCC Director of Investigations wrote in a letter to North Yorkshire Police: "I am now able to let you know we have completed that review of all the evidence and material relating to the late Jimmy Savile and have decided to take no further action with regard to your force."
